(This is D� an existing system [ ] new construction) SYSTEM CONFORMITY C1-3): 1 "CODE SYSTEM"-A system which meets all the location, design, and construction standards of the current City Codes, and which is operating satisfactorily by treating and disposing of the entire current sewage input without discharging any pollutants into ground or surface Waters. 2 "CONFORMING SYSTEM"-A system which does not meet all the location, design, and construction standards of the current City Codes, but Was installed according to the code in effect at the time of installation, and which is operating satisfactorily by treating and disposing of the entire current sewage input without discharging any pollutants tnto ground or surface waters. 3 "NON-CONFORMING SYSTEM��-A prohibited system; a system located aithin a designated 100-year floodplain; any system which may or may not meet all the location, design, and construction standards of the current City Codes and which is failing for any reason; and any system with less than 3 feet of unsaturated soil or sand between the distribution device and the limiting soil characteristics. (The limiting soil characteristic�,P� has or [ ] has not been identified at this time. If the limiting soil characteristic has not been identified, this classification may be subject to revision.)
